Biography of Al Pacino
Al Pacino, born Alfredo James Pacino on April 25, 1940, in East Harlem, New York, is a celebrated American actor known for his intense and riveting performances. Raised in the Bronx by his mother and grandparents, Pacino's early life was marked by financial struggles and familial challenges. Despite these obstacles, he found solace in acting, eventually becoming one of the most influential figures in the film industry.

Early Life and Acting Career
Al Pacino's introduction to acting began in his teenage years at the High School of Performing Arts in Manhattan. However, due to academic difficulties, he dropped out at age 17. Determined to pursue his passion, Pacino joined the Herbert Berghof Studio, where he honed his craft under the guidance of influential acting teacher, Charlie Laughton.
Pacino's stage debut came in 1967 with a role in the play "Awake and Sing!" His performance earned him critical acclaim, paving the way for a series of successful stage roles. By the late 1960s, Pacino was a prominent figure in New York's theater scene, known for his intense dedication and method acting techniques.
Rise to Stardom
The 1970s marked a significant turning point in Al Pacino's career. In 1972, he starred as Michael Corleone in Francis Ford Coppola's "The Godfather," a role that catapulted him to international fame. The film was a massive success, earning Pacino his first Academy Award nomination and establishing him as a leading actor in Hollywood.
Following "The Godfather," Pacino continued to captivate audiences with a string of iconic performances. His portrayal of Frank Serpico in "Serpico" (1973) and Sonny Wortzik in "Dog Day Afternoon" (1975) further solidified his reputation as a versatile and powerful actor. These roles not only showcased his range but also his ability to bring complex characters to life with authenticity and depth.
Al Pacino's Iconic Roles
Throughout his illustrious career, Al Pacino has delivered numerous unforgettable performances. His portrayal of Tony Montana in "Scarface" (1983) remains one of the most iconic roles in cinematic history, with Pacino's intense performance becoming a cultural phenomenon.
Other notable roles include his depiction of Lieutenant Colonel Frank Slade in "Scent of a Woman" (1992), for which he won his first Academy Award for Best Actor. His ability to immerse himself in diverse roles, from the ruthless mobster in "The Godfather" series to the blind, retired army officer in "Scent of a Woman," underscores his unparalleled talent and versatility as an actor.
Personal Life and Family
Despite his fame, Al Pacino has maintained a relatively private personal life. He has never been married but has three children. His daughter, Julie Marie, was born in 1989, and he has twins, Anton James and Olivia Rose, born in 2001 with actress Beverly D'Angelo.
Pacino's dedication to his craft often overshadowed his personal life, leading to a series of high-profile relationships over the years. Despite the challenges that come with being a Hollywood icon, Pacino has managed to balance his professional and personal life, finding joy in fatherhood and maintaining close relationships with his children.
